How does Kentucky Lake water affect my home's plumbing?

Kentucky Lake provides hard water with high mineral content that causes scale buildup throughout your plumbing system. Water heaters accumulate sediment faster, reducing efficiency and shortening their lifespan. Fixtures develop mineral deposits that restrict flow and damage seals over time. Installing a whole-house water softener or using dielectric unions at connections can mitigate these effects.

What specific plumbing problems occur in 1980s copper systems?

Pinhole leaks develop in 44-year-old copper pipes due to decades of water chemistry interaction and normal wear. Joint calcification is another common issue where mineral deposits build up at connections, restricting flow and creating weak points. These failures often appear first in hot water lines and at elbows where water turbulence accelerates erosion. Early detection through pressure testing can prevent extensive water damage.
